9 Must-Visit Religious Places In Bengaluru

A renowned temple dedicated to Lord Krishna, featuring beautiful architecture and spiritual ambiance

ISKCON Temple, Bangalore

One of the oldest temples in Bangalore, known for its massive granite Nandi (bull) statue dedicated to Lord Shiva

Bull Temple (Nandi Temple)

Famous for its unique architecture and the annual phenomenon of sunlight passing between the horns of the Nandi idol to illuminate the Shivalinga

Gavi Gangadhareshwara Temple
